Self Hosting n8n: Ein DevOps Engineer’s Guide zur vollständigen Automatisierungskontrolle
Als ich zum ersten Mal auf n8n stieß, suchte ich nach einem Workflow-Automatisierungstool, das mit meinem umfangreichen Home Lab Setup Schritt hält, ohne meine Daten in die Cloud zu schicken. Mit über 15 self-hosted Services für 200+ Personen in Kiew ist Privatsphäre nicht nur eine Präferenz — es ist eine Vorgabe. Die open-source, self-hosted Natur von n8n hat mich sofort fasziniert. Doch beim Testen entdeckte ich, dass die wahre Kraft nicht nur in den Funktionen liegt, sondern vor allem in der Kontrolle, die das Self Hosting ermöglicht.
Warum Self Hosting von n8n wichtig ist
Die meisten Automatisierungsplattformen werben mit einfacher Bedienung, sperren dich aber in ihre Ökosysteme ein. Ich habe unzählige Unternehmen gesehen, die ihre Datenautonomie verlieren und mit steigenden Abonnementkosten konfrontiert werden. Mit n8n self-hosted laufen Workflows auf eigenen Servern, hinter der eigenen Firewall, mit unbegrenzter Anpassbarkeit.
Es gibt eine Freiheit darin, dein Automatisierung-Stack selbst zu kontrollieren. Es geht nicht nur ums Geldsparen; es geht auch darum, sensible Workflows zu schützen, die kritische Dienste wie Jira, Slack oder eigene APIs integrieren. Ich betreibe n8n auf einem bescheidenen Intel NUC mit 16GB RAM — für unter 600 Dollar — und es verarbeitet problemlos Dutzende gleichzeitiger Workflows.
Verwende Docker Compose, um deine n8n-Deployment zu verwalten — das vereinfacht Skalierung und Updates enorm.

Einrichtung von n8n: Hardware, Software und Kosten
Self hosting von n8n ist keine Raketenwissenschaft, aber die kluge Wahl deiner Infrastruktur macht den Unterschied. Ich empfehle, n8n auf einem dedizierten Linux-Server oder einem leistungsstarken NAS-Gerät laufen zu lassen. Hier ein Überblick über beliebte Setups, die ich getestet habe:
| Gerät | Spezifikationen | Preis (USD) | Vorteile | Nachteile |
|---|---|---|---|---|
| Intel NUC 11 | i5, 16GB RAM, 512GB SSD | 600 $ | Kompakt, energieeffizient, zuverlässig | Höhere Anfangsinvestition |
| Synology DS920+ | 4-Kern CPU, 4GB RAM (erweiterbar) | 550 $ | Integriertes NAS + n8n, einfache Speicherverwaltung | Begrenzte CPU-Leistung für schwere Workflows |
| Raspberry Pi 4 | Quad-core ARM, 8GB RAM | 75 $ | Günstig, geringer Stromverbrauch | Leistungsgrenzen bei hoher Belastung |
Ich persönlich nutze den Intel NUC wegen seines guten Preis-Leistungs-Verhältnisses. Die Mindestanforderungen von n8n sind bescheiden — 512MB RAM und 1 CPU-Kern — aber für einen zuverlässigen Multi-User-Betrieb sind 16GB RAM und 4 Kerne optimal.
In vernünftige Hardware zu investieren, reduziert Ausfallzeiten und Wartungsaufwand beim Self Hosting von n8n erheblich.
→ Siehe auch: Was ist Self Hosting? Expertenrat 2024 | Viktor Marchenko
Installation und Konfiguration: Von Null zum Automatisierungs-Profi
Ich habe verschiedene Installationsmethoden getestet: Docker, Kubernetes und Bare-metal. Docker Compose überzeugt durch Einfachheit und einfache Upgrades.
Hier eine kurze Übersicht meines bevorzugten Docker-Setups:
- Installiere Docker und Docker Compose auf deinem Server.
- Erstelle eine
docker-compose.yml-Datei mit dem offiziellen n8n-Image. - Mappe Ports und Volumes für Persistenz.
- Setze Umgebungsvariablen wie
N8N_BASIC_AUTH_ACTIVE, um Authentifizierung zu aktivieren. - Starte mit
docker-compose up -d.
Innerhalb weniger Minuten hast du eine voll funktionsfähige n8n-Instanz, die im lokalen Netzwerk erreichbar ist oder sicher über VPN exponiert werden kann.
Sicherheit ist essenziell. Ich konfiguriere immer HTTPS mit Let's Encrypt über einen Reverse Proxy wie Traefik oder Nginx. Das ist ein kleiner Schritt, der verhindert, dass Zugangsdaten und API-Keys abhandenkommen.
Automatisiere regelmäßige Backups deiner Workflow-JSON-Dateien und der n8n-Datenbank, um Datenverlust zu vermeiden.

Praxisnahe Vorteile: Einsparungen, Kontrolle und Geschwindigkeit
Seit ich auf self-hosted n8n umgestiegen bin, spare ich etwa 150 $ pro Monat im Vergleich zu SaaS-Plattformen wie Zapier oder Make (ehemals Integromat). Noch wichtiger ist, dass ich meine Daten und Workflows selbst in der Hand habe.
Die Geschwindigkeitssteigerung ist deutlich spürbar. Workflows laufen auf meinem lokalen Server 20-30 % schneller, weil die Netzwerk-Latenz geringer ist.
Ein aktueller Kunde sparte monatlich 15 Stunden durch die Automatisierung der Ticket-Erstellung und Benachrichtigungen auf mehreren Plattformen — eine Aufgabe, die zuvor manuell erledigt wurde.
“Self hosting n8n gibt Unternehmen die Agilität der Cloud-Automatisierung, ohne die Datenhoheit aufzugeben.” — Jan Kowalski, CTO, AutomateIT
Vergleich: n8n mit anderen Automation-Tools
| Tool | Preise | Self-Hosting | API-Integrationen | Anpassbarkeit |
|---|---|---|---|---|
| n8n | Kostenlos (Open Source) + Cloud ab 20 $/Monat | Ja | 200+ native Nodes + eigene HTTP Requests | Hoch (Node.js basiert) |
| Zapier | Beginnt bei 19,99 $/Monat | Nein | 3000+ Apps | Mittel |
| Make (Integromat) | Beginnt bei 9 $/Monat | Nein | 1000+ Apps | Mittel |
| Node-RED | Kostenlos | Ja | Anpassbar, aber weniger vorgefertigte Nodes | Hoch |

→ Siehe auch: Ein Heim-Lab für Anfänger aufbauen: Praktischer Leitfaden 2024
Vor- und Nachteile des Self Hostings von n8n
• Volle Kontrolle über Daten und Workflows
• Kein Vendor Lock-in oder wiederkehrende SaaS-Gebühren
• Hochgradig anpassbar mit Open-Source-Code
• Einfach skalierbar mit Docker oder Kubernetes
• Grundlegende DevOps-Kenntnisse für Einrichtung und Wartung erforderlich
• Anfangsinvestition in Hardware und Zeit
• Selbstverantwortung für Sicherheit und Backups
Praktische Tipps für das Management deiner n8n-Workflows
Ich empfehle folgende Routine, um die Zuverlässigkeit deiner Automatisierung sicherzustellen:
- Versioniere deine Workflows: Exportiere JSON und committe es in Git.
- Überwache die Workflow-Ausführung: Nutze die integrierten Logs von n8n und externe Tools wie Prometheus.
- Begrenze die Komplexität deiner Workflows: Zerlege große Workflows in kleinere, manageable Abschnitte.
- Verwende Environment Variables: Sichere API-Keys und Passwörter außerhalb des Workflow-Codes.
Skalierung von n8n für Teams
Wenn dein Team wächst, skaliert n8n mit. Ich habe n8n auf Kubernetes-Clustern mit Helm Charts bereitgestellt, was Zero-Downtime-Upgrades und hohe Verfügbarkeit ermöglicht. Teammitglieder erhalten rollenbasierte Zugriffe, während das Teilen von Workflows die Zusammenarbeit verbessert.
Laut einem Forrester-Bericht von 2023 haben Unternehmen, die self-hosted Automation-Plattformen einsetzen, die manuelle Bearbeitungszeit im Durchschnitt um 40 % reduziert.
→ Siehe auch: Selbsthosting Home Lab für Anfänger: Starte noch heute 2024
Häufige Fallstricke und wie man sie vermeidet
- Sicherheit ignorieren: Immer Authentifizierung und HTTPS aktivieren.
- Workflows überladen: Komplexe Workflows können die Ausführung verlangsamen; modularisiere deine Logik.
- Backups vernachlässigen: Plane automatisierte Backups deiner Datenbank und Workflows.
Integriere n8n mit Prometheus und Grafana für Echtzeit-Überwachung und Alarmierung bei Workflow-Fehlern.
FAQ
Welcher Hardwarebedarf ist für den effektiven Betrieb von n8n notwendig?
Kann ich n8n mit eigenen APIs integrieren?
Wie sichere ich meine self-hosted n8n-Instanz?
Gibt es eine Community oder Support für n8n?
Fazit
Self hosting von n8n versetzt dich in die Fahrerposition. Du hast volle Kontrolle, senkst Kosten und schützt deine Daten, während du komplexe Workflows automatisierst, die deine Produktivität steigern. Ob auf einem 600-Dollar Intel NUC oder einem Kubernetes-Cluster — n8n passt sich deinem Maßstab und deinen Bedürfnissen an.
Wenn du bisher zögerlich beim Self Hosting warst, bedenke die langfristigen Vorteile: Privatsphäre, Anpassbarkeit und Kosteneinsparungen. Starte klein, experimentiere mit Workflows und baue ein System, das wirklich dir gehört.
Bereit, die Kontrolle über deine Automatisierung zu übernehmen? Starte noch heute dein n8n und revolutioniere deine Arbeitsweise.
Viktor Marchenko — DevOps Engineer, Kiew, Datenschutzaktivist, Home Lab Builder

Kommentare 0
Seien Sie der Erste, der kommentiert!